PolyAI

Software Engineer - Graduate (Must be in UK)

London, UK
API Python C++ Java
Search for More Jobs Talk to a recruiter now πŸ’ͺ
Description

PolyAI is tackling the challenges of automating customer service through voice. Our voice assistants make it possible for businesses to deliver outstanding customer service at every touchpoint.

This is voice-enabled, AI-driven customer service that works in the real world, right now.

As part of the project team, you will take a lead role in developing real-world systems for our customers that take 1000s of calls every single day. You will work closely with PolyAI Product Solutions Managers and Dialogue Designers to build out and maintain highly specialized software that delights our clients and their customers.

Your responsibilities will involve:

  • Contributing to our conversational AI systems – building new projects as well as maintaining existing ones.
  • Communicating with client technical teams on API & telephony integrations.
  • Co-working with Product Solutions Managers and Dialogue Designers to produce a great conversational UX.
  • Support of existing deployments during working hours.

Minimum Requirements:

  • BS degree in a technical field involving coding, or equivalent industry experience.
  • 1+ year(s) of Python / C++ / Java experience, or equivalent.
  • You are a fast learner.
  • Proficiency in verbal and written English communication.

Preferred Requirements:

  • Experience in software development within an industrial setting, contributing to product-level engineering tasks.
  • Knowledge of REST/SOAP APIs and associated technologies such as OAuth2.0 and TLS
  • Knowledge of telephony protocols such as SIP, or knowledge of other networking protocols
  • Understanding of the software deployment cycle, including local deployments, testing, code reviews etc.
  • Permission to work in the UK.

Our interview process:

  • An initial phone call (30 minutes) with the talent and hiring manager
  • A take-home coding problem
  • Two back-to-back technical interviews (45 minutes each). One interview will ask you to implement a basic Python client within our proprietary policy framework, given an API specification. The other interview will be a more generic programming interview focusing on understanding your current technical ability and experience.
  • A 30-minute behavioural interview with our Management Team.

Equal Opportunity Statement:

PolyAI is proud to be an equal-opportunity employer. We celebrate diversity and are committed to creating an inclusive environment for all employees.

All employment decisions at PolyAI will be based on the business needs without attention to ethnicity, religion, sexual orientation, gender identity, family or parental status, national origin, neurodiversity status or disability status.

PolyAI
PolyAI
Artificial Intelligence Call Center Customer Service Enterprise Software Machine Learning Software

0 applies

2 views

There are more than 50,000 engineering jobs:

Subscribe to membership and unlock all jobs

Engineering Jobs

60,000+ jobs from 4,500+ well-funded companies

Updated Daily

New jobs are added every day as companies post them

Refined Search

Use filters like skill, location, etc to narrow results

Become a member

πŸ₯³πŸ₯³πŸ₯³ 401 happy customers and counting...

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.

To try it out

For active job seekers

For those who are passive looking

Cancel anytime

Frequently Asked Questions

  • We prioritize job seekers as our customers, unlike bigger job sites, by charging a small fee to provide them with curated access to the best companies and up-to-date jobs. This focus allows us to deliver a more personalized and effective job search experience.
  • We've got about 70,000 jobs from 5,000 vetted companies. No fake or sleazy jobs here!
  • We aggregate jobs from 5,000+ companies' career pages, so you can be sure that you're getting the most up-to-date and relevant jobs.
  • We're the only job board *for* software engineers, *by* software engineers… in case you needed a reminder! We add thousands of new jobs daily and offer powerful search filters just for you. πŸ› οΈ
  • Every single hour! We add 2,000-3,000 new jobs daily, so you'll always have fresh opportunities. πŸš€
  • Typically, job searches take 3-6 months. EchoJobs helps you spend more time applying and less time hunting. 🎯
  • Check daily! We're always updating with new jobs. Set up job alerts for even quicker access. πŸ“…

What Fellow Engineers Say